Transaction 840415e54fc7f061da2beb9a6edb7255b24d135197941e329d802469a2a48a99
1 Input
2 Outputs
- 840415e54fc7f061da2beb9a6edb7255b24d135197941e329d802469a2a48a99:0
- 840415e54fc7f061da2beb9a6edb7255b24d135197941e329d802469a2a48a99:1
value 2921056
address 1CCLqWmpoKNywRk7wreSndGCRq3vPqjDdc
value 1156667050
address 32mpTkbTs5Gy9bTL1KuVDgtuXw3wFR9ufu